The part number alone does not guarantee fitment across every Cummins engine variant.
I once had a customer order a Belt Tensioner 3976832 based on an older service manual. The number matched, but the manufacturer had since updated the arm geometry and spline count on newer revisions. The tensioner bolted to the bracket but misaligned the belt by a few millimetres, causing premature wear within the first week. This is not rare β Cummins B5.9, ISB, and QSB engine families share some OEM reference numbers while differing in pulley offset and spring rate between builds [NEED_CITE: Cummins belt drive accessory configuration variance across engine families]. Ordering from an unverified cross-reference list is the most common reason a belt tensioner arrives and does not sit correctly on the accessory drive.

The arm is machined from SAE 1045 steel with induction hardening applied specifically at the pivot points, reaching 52β56 HRC where cyclical loading concentrates. The sealed deep-groove ball bearing conforms to ISO 15243, which defines the fatigue life classification for rolling bearings under the oscillating loads typical of a tensioner. Dimensional tolerance is held to Β±0.15 mm per ASME Y14.5 GD&T β this matters because even a slight deviation in pulley offset will cause the belt to track off-centre, accelerating edge wear on both the belt and adjacent idler pulleys. The torsion spring is calibrated to within Β±3% force tolerance, maintaining the 45β55 Nm static tension range that keeps the accessory drive belt engaged without overloading the bearing.
A tensioner that bolts on but sits a few millimetres off the correct pulley plane will not cause an immediate failure. Instead, the belt develops uneven wear patterns, the bearing experiences side-loading it was not designed for, and the accessory drive begins to slip under load [NEED_CITE: belt mistracking effects on accessory drive bearing life]. By the time the fault becomes obvious, the belt, the tensioner bearing, and potentially the driven accessory pulley all require replacement β turning a single-component swap into a multi-part repair that keeps the machine down longer than necessary.

Q: Why do multiple Cummins engine variants share some numbers but not others? A: Cummins engine families like ISB, QSB, and 6CT share base architecture but differ in accessory drive layout, pulley sizes, and belt routing. A tensioner number may apply to several builds where the accessory bracket is identical, but diverge where arm length or spring calibration was changed for a different accessory load [NEED_CITE: Cummins engine family accessory drive configuration differences].
